Mumbai, Feb 21 (NationPress) The Mumbai Crime Branch, in collaboration with Buldhana Police, arrested two suspects on Friday in relation to a threatening email directed at Maharashtra Deputy Chief Minister Eknath Shinde.

The detainees, identified as Mangesh Wayal (35) and Abhay Shingane (22), reside in Deulgaon Mahi within the Deulgaon Raja taluka of Buldhana district. They are being transported to Mumbai for further questioning.

These individuals will be presented before a court to seek custody.

The inquiry was initiated after the Goregaon Police Station received a threatening email on Thursday, which warned of a bomb targeting Deputy CM Shinde’s vehicle. In response, an FIR was filed under Sections 351(3), 351(4), and 353(2) of the Bharatiya Nyaya Sanhita.

Despite the threat, Deputy CM Shinde proceeded with his official obligations. He was present at the swearing-in ceremony of Delhi Chief Minister Rekha Gupta on Thursday, joined by Chief Minister Devendra Fadnavis and fellow Deputy CM Ajit Pawar. Subsequently, Shinde fulfilled additional public commitments as planned.

In response to the event, Shiv Sena spokesperson Kiran Hegde remarked, “These actions seem to stem from pranksters, but law enforcement should treat this matter with the utmost seriousness. It is vital to impose strict penalties to deter such offenders from making threats in the future. DCM Shinde remains a leader respected by many and is undeterred by such intimidation. He has served throughout various regions of the state, including Naxal-affected areas like Gadchiroli. However, these threats must be taken seriously by the authorities.”

This incident has sparked a political debate, with opposition figures raising concerns about the law and order situation in Maharashtra.

Nevertheless, officials have confirmed that all necessary security protocols are being enforced and that the investigation is advancing across multiple channels.
